Last year, Lietchtenstein joined the LNY bandwagon. Unlike the other countries' issues, theirs have a unique feature. From stampnews.com, "For the first time a postage stamp is appearing in silhouette form. For the purpose the face design by Stefan Erne was cut out using state-of-the art laser technology."

BTW, it's interesting to note that readers of Canada Post's "details" magazine have voted at least twice that their LNY issues are least relevant to the Canadian society. This is even though Canada has a sizeable Chinese population. I guess the world's post offices are just after the potential revenue they can get from the Chinese???
